The construction and manufacturing sectors are contending with a persistent productivity paradox: despite significant investment in digital tools, modular construction, and lean manufacturing techniques, productivity growth has lagged other industries for decades. Labour shortages both skilled trades and engineering talent are a structural constraint, compounded by project cost inflation driven by materials price volatility and logistics disruption.
In construction, the shift toward green building standards, net-zero targets, and embodied carbon accounting is fundamentally changing specification decisions, procurement priorities, and project economics, yet many contractors and developers remain ill-equipped to navigate these requirements commercially. In manufacturing, nearshoring and friend-shoring trends are driving facility location decisions that require deep understanding of local labour markets, regulatory environments, and supply base maturity. The industry gap is in actionable market intelligence at the project pipeline and procurement intent level. Both sectors suffer from fragmented data environments where it is difficult to aggregate meaningful demand signals, understand competitor positioning in key accounts, or track how brand reputation influences specification decisions among architects, engineers, and procurement managers.
